Understanding Value in Betting Markets

At the heart of profitable betting lies the concept of value. A value bet isn't simply picking a winner; it's about identifying situations where the odds offered by a bookmaker are higher than the true probability of an event occurring. This discrepancy represents a positive expected value, meaning that over the long run, consistently exploiting these opportunities will yield a profit. Determining true probability, however, is where the challenge lies. It requires thorough research, statistical analysis, and a keen understanding of the factors influencing the outcome of an event. For instance, a team might be underestimated by bookmakers due to recent poor form, but a deeper dive reveals key player injuries on the opposing side, significantly altering the expected outcome. Identifying these nuances is what separates informed bettors from those relying on gut feelings.

Effective Bankroll Management Techniques

Even with a sophisticated betting strategy, poor bankroll management can quickly erode profits. Bankroll management is the practice of controlling the amount of money you wager, ensuring that you can withstand inevitable losing streaks without jeopardizing your overall capital. A common rule of thumb is to wager no more than 1-5% of your bankroll on a single bet. This limits your potential losses and allows you to ride out fluctuations in form. It’s vital to treat betting as a long-term investment rather than a get-rich-quick scheme. Emotional betting, driven by the desire to recoup losses quickly, is a common pitfall that can lead to reckless wagering and significant financial setbacks. Discipline and adherence to a pre-defined bankroll management plan are paramount for sustained success.

Staking Plans: Flat, Proportional, and Kelly Criterion

There are several different staking plans that bettors can employ. The flat staking plan involves wagering the same amount on every bet, regardless of the perceived probability of success. This is a simple and conservative approach. A proportional staking plan, on the other hand, adjusts the wager size based on the perceived value of the bet. Higher-value bets receive larger wagers, while lower-value bets receive smaller wagers. The Kelly Criterion is a more advanced staking plan that aims to maximize long-term growth by calculating the optimal wager size based on the perceived edge and the bookmaker's odds. However, the Kelly Criterion can be risky as it often recommends large wagers, and its accuracy depends on the precision of your probability estimates. Careful consideration of your risk tolerance and betting experience is essential when choosing a staking plan.

  • Flat Staking: Simple, low risk, slow growth.
  • Proportional Staking: Moderate risk, moderate growth.
  • Kelly Criterion: High risk, potentially high growth (requires accurate probabilities).
  • Martingale System: Doubling down after losses – extremely risky and not recommended.

Choosing the right staking plan is a crucial component of a sound betting strategy. While the Kelly Criterion can be attractive, it's often more prudent for beginners to start with a flat or proportional staking plan and gradually refine their approach as their skills and experience develop.

Beyond the Odds: Behavioral Psychology in Betting

Understanding the psychological biases that affect both bettors and oddsmakers is a frequently overlooked element of success. Cognitive biases like confirmation bias (seeking information that confirms pre-existing beliefs) and the gambler's fallacy (believing that past events influence future independent events) can lead to irrational betting decisions. Bookmakers often exploit these biases to their advantage, setting odds that appeal to the emotional tendencies of the general public. By recognizing these biases in yourself and others, you can make more objective and informed bets. Additionally, understanding the psychology of teams and players – their motivations, anxieties, and responses to pressure – can provide valuable insights into potential outcomes. For example, a team facing a must-win situation might exhibit a different level of performance than a team playing with less at stake. Cultivating a detached and analytical mindset is essential for mitigating the influence of psychological biases and maximizing your long-term profitability.
